My 700th review is dedicated to Flor and her daughters who own and operate the most delicious seafood stand in Baja California. It is located just south on the free (libre) road that goes from Rosarito Beach to Ensenada. From the toll (cuota) road you take the Cantamar (Primo Tapia) exit at marker KM53 and go two blocks south. I have been enjoying Flor's fish tacos for over 20 years. Light and crispy batter is put on fresh fish and fried so fast and hot that it doesn't get greasy or oily. Light and airy. At the same time, handmade masa is rolled and flattened and then put on a very hot flat top to make that beautiful flour tortilla in the picture. It is almost crepe-like in texture, with tasty little burn marks. You get to dress up your taco with all the things that Flor has prepared such as shredded cabbage, crema, salsa fresca (cruda), marinated sliced white onions, salsa picante and limon (lime). You cannot find a piece of fish in a fish taco this large anywhere along the coast of Baja California. This is the king of the fish tacos. One fish taco this size is $2. Two is a lot to eat. I always have two. Flor also has shrimp cocktails, ceviche, caldo de siete mares and many other mariscos on the menu. Only soft drinks are here, but there is a beer distributor across the street. Cantamar (Primo Tapia) is about 11 miles south of downtown Rosarito Beach along the ocean. It has some of the best local restaurants without the crowds, noise and bad behavior of the low-life tourists in Rosarito Beach.
